Transaction 19fca2cf174cfa6798b1fa13fa56290676fa4417a95974a4e4eaace5edcf9830
1 Input
2 Outputs
- 19fca2cf174cfa6798b1fa13fa56290676fa4417a95974a4e4eaace5edcf9830:0
- 19fca2cf174cfa6798b1fa13fa56290676fa4417a95974a4e4eaace5edcf9830:1
value 21163523
address 1R8iHGsqbvzikN4jXwSU4ga9yESzTZ1or
value 27799744
address 14Lmvg3ubh6122UAyvxqhr7RP2SyfWoP6T